limber

 
Adjective limber has 2 senses
  1. limber, supple - (used of e.g. personality traits) readily adaptable; "a supple mind"; "a limber imagination"
    Antonym: inflexible (indirect, via flexible)
  2. limber, supple - (used of persons' bodies) capable of moving or bending freely
    Antonym: inflexible (indirect, via flexible)
Noun limber has 1 sense
  1. limber - a two-wheeled horse-drawn vehicle used to pull a field gun or caisson
    --1 is a kind of
    horse-drawn vehicle
Verb limber has 2 senses
  1. limber, limber up - attach the limber; "limber a cannon"
    --1 is one way to attach
    Sample sentence:
    Somebody ----s something
  2. limber - cause to become limber; "The violist limbered her wrists before the concert"
    --2 is one way to
    warm up
